We've missed you, farmer's markets. Minnesotans can feel a little vitamin deprived after the long winter, and spring sunshine and fresh fruits and vegetables are the much-needed antidote.
This week and next week see the opening of several farmer's markets across the Twin Cities. Fresh, local produce, flowers, plants and baked goods make it so worthwhile to get up early on a weekend morning!
- The Nicollet Mall Farmer's Market in downtown Minneapolis opens Thursday April 24.
- The Lyndale Avenue Farmer's Market just west of downtown Minneapolis opens Saturday April 26.
- The Downtown St. Paul Farmer's Market opens on the weekend of April 26 and 27.
- The Midtown Farmer's Market opens on May 3.
- The Mill City Farmer's Market begins May 10.
